States eye mileage taxes as gas use declines

Oregon is among a growing number of states exploring ways to tax drivers based on the number of miles they drive instead of how much gas they use, even going so far as to install GPS monitoring devices in 300 vehicles.

The idea first emerged nearly 10 years ago as Oregon lawmakers worried that fuel-efficient cars such as gas-electric hybrids could pose a threat to road upkeep, which is paid for largely with gasoline taxes.

Texas jail closes after recliners found in cells

McGaughey declined to say what prompted the investigation, also being conducted by the Texas Rangers. But he said authorities found contraband in the jail. New Sheriff Paul Cunningham moved the inmates to the Wise County jail on Thursday a few hours after he was sworn in.

McGaughey said some surveillance cameras’ cords had been disconnected; recliners were in cells; some bathrooms and cells could be locked from the inside; and inmates had made partitions out of paper towels to block jailers’ views inside their cells. One alarming discovery was a type of rack made of nails, he said.

“This action was taken because there was a concern for the safety of the prisoners and the jail personnel,” McGaughey said Friday.

Two people lightly hurt when rocket hits Ashdod building

As Operation Cast Lead moves into its second week, Palestinians showed no signs of ending their rocket attacks against Israel, firing at least 20 projectiles on Saturday morning.

Two people were lightly wounded by shrapnel when an eight-story building in Ashdod sustained a direct hit by a Grad-type rocket. At least three other people on the scene were treated for shock.

A number of buildings were also damaged by rockets on Saturday. One rocket hit a cafeteria in a kibbutz on the Gaza periphery, another slammed into a courtyard of a house in Ashkelon, sparking a fire, a third hit a playground in the city, while a fourth damaged a building in the Ashkelon beach area. Netivot, Sderot, Gan Yavne, Kiryat Malachi, the Sha’ar Hanegev region, and the Eshkol region also reported rocket strikes.

Atheists sue to get prayer, God out of inauguration

A group of atheists, led by a California man known for challenging the use of the words “under God” in recitals of the Pledge of Allegiance at public schools, filed a lawsuit this week to bar prayer and references to God at the swearing-in of President-elect Barack Obama.

Michael A. Newdow, 17 other individuals and 10 groups representing atheists sued Supreme Court Chief Justice John Roberts, several officials in charge of inaugural festivities, the Rev. Joseph Lowery and megachurch pastor Rick Warren. They filed the complaint Tuesday in U.S. District Court.
